canyonero posted:I bought her for my Sera Surfer deck and it's been great (yes I'm awful at knowing when to snap). The location copies Rogue after her On Reveal happens. After the On Reveal, she loses her On Reveal gains the Ongoing. So middle Rogue has Patriot's ability copied from the left Rogue but won't steal. You can see your broodlings are +4 relative to Brood because you have two Patriot Ongoings active.

Red Rox posted:I sometimes get real paranoid about how this game works. For example, I switched to an Infinaut deck and cruised from 40 to 50 in a couple of days. Then as soon as I hit 50, I'm completely stuck, bouncing between 49-52. Could very well be the game putting a finger on the scale to funnel you towards $$ but for what it's worth: True randomness fucks with our brains. Researchers have done coin flip studies that participants report as rigged (they weren't) and fair when they were rigged to "feel" fair. there's also a famous tech example of the iTunes team making shuffle not truly random because people kept complaining it was favoring certain songs.

the_american_dream posted:What’s the next one? Think it was posted but I missed it It's Zabu, who is Kazar's tiger. It's a 3/2 that makes all your 4-cost cards cost 2 less (minimum 1). It's strong enough to play, but it's a weak body on the board and there aren't that many broken combos that revolve around 4s. Dracula discard is the obvious immediate use, although turn 4 Wong/Shuri into turn 5 Panther won't be bad.
